Saltwater_Thief

The whole strat revolved around a really janky interaction I stumbled on where if an Op is on the leftmost ranged tile in the row with the smoke tiles, Manfred will stop moving inside the gate and attack them until either they die, his phase is pushed, or a new target appears closer to him; with Nightengale and Silence supporting her Goldenglow could tank him forever even with Enemy Attack Up 2, and with nothing else breaking her shields Mudrock could take cannonfire for the same duration. So once all the first half enemies dried up it was just a matter of waiting for Pink Catto to wear him down with volume of attacks, and then when he looped around S3 Amiya was waiting to chew through the majority of his life.

Frozen5147

[Max risk for day 6,](https://youtu.be/tSuChrdblP0) 7 ops, no leaks. No Ling. This was surprisingly fun, even though it's, well, WR mechanics. The attack speed debuff is annoying but it's made up for by the enemies not being too hard-hitting/tanky comparatively, and thankfully Free isn't the annoying one with Weft and Warp today. The opening is handled by triple vanguard (Elysium S2, Saileach S3, Cantabile S2). There was a bit of trickiness here for me since my Cantabile S2 is only M2, which means I have to deactivate early on my first usage to have it up in time for another full use - this is mostly not needed if you take M3, or at least the timing window is *far* more generous without it. Bagpipe would also make it much easier. However, I found during my attempts that you can just partially use it as well and still have enough DP, though it does make some things a bit tighter for the first Envy. The middle core is Kal, Mudrock, and Gnosis who, after having all their colours swapped, can pretty easily handle everything up to Free with the aid of the vanguards. The only thing to pay attention to is the Envies, who need to be CC'd during their colour switch skill. That's fairly easy though with Red, Gnosis, Mudrock, or Saileach all being able to do so, and CDs aren't too tight for this. The first Envy also needs to be blocked for a few seconds to allow Mudrock to tank the Smarty instead, which Red can do. Then comes Free. Phase one isn't too bad - Gnosis can facetank its shield explosion due to the colour swap to black, allowing him to continue to DPS if he gets heals, and Mudrock can barely make it out alive tanking Free as long as her shields are up during the explosion. This means that all the other random enemies *must* be killed ASAP to allow Mudrock's shields to be not consumed by their attacks (and to not die to Free's normal attacks). And after you get past that, Mudrock can easily tank phase two of Free by just existing due to the colour match - at this point of trying all you need to do is wait and slap Free to death with all your other operators.

Koekelbag

Place mudrock in the very bottom left to safely bait mortars (and doing nothing else) while blocking all of the right-side enemies on the 2 vents (operators on vents can't be targeted by the cannon even if they are blocking) and taking out the left side enemies with ranged units. Or use only ranged units and multiple fast-redeploys instead, making sure you always have a fast-redeploy deployed last so they'll be targeted. You can't survive the cannon fire, but that's not a problem when they can come back before the next strike, which also gives you freedom on where you want the blast to hit.

whimsy_wanderer

Welcome aboard! This is a very impressive result for a new player! You sound a bit apologetic when you talk about watching guides, so I wanted to say that there is nothing wrong about it. You can learn a lot from them if you look from a position of how they achieved this and why they did that instead of just copying them step by step. From your description you clearly have the right approach to them. Actually, watching guides after you've cleared the stage can be even more enlightening, because by that time you already know what problems you've faced in that stage and will be looking at how the guide solves those (or even how it avoids them completely). I remember learning an awful lot in my first CC. CC with zero sanity cost and dynamic difficulty in the form of contracts creates a very good environment for practicing and experimenting. And reddit thread(s) where people share their clears provides a lot of reference material to look at. In my first daily map I went from "risk 8 is impossibly hard" to "risk 10 is done, I wonder what I can take for risk 11" in a few hours.
